Hi All, I know I've seen this question somewhere on this forum but I couldnt find it. When you pur- chase a complete upper receiver, does the bolt have to be fitted to it? Or does the headspace depend on the barrel fit into the upper? The reason I ask is because I have a couple of complete bolt assemblys and would like to purchase a complete upper without the bolt for the cost savings. Thanks, Bill |
|
Swapping the same bolt between barrels will increase the wear on the bolt. Its best to spend the $40 or so and have a bolt for each upper. Bolt carriers can be swapped with no issues. AR-15s headspace is set at the factory you can't adjust it - just test to see if its 'in spec' or not. If its 'not' then you need a new bolt and/or barrel. |
